First Paper Produced At SAICAs New Partington Recycled Paper Mill

24 January 2012

SAICA's new recycled paper mill in Partington has produced its first paper ahead of schedule, following successful trials of the company's Paper Machine 11 (PM11)

The production of SAICA's first sellable paper at Partington marks the return of the paper industry to Trafford, and the beginning of a new chapter in British papermaking.

On Sunday 15 January, PM11 successfully produced paper for the first time, with paper running through the whole machine and paper reels being processed along the whole line.

The first sellable paper reels were produced and tested, leaving the mill and reaching the first customers shortly afterwards.

The £300m recycled paper mill - SAICA's first in the UK and the first new containerboard paper mill in the UK for decades - will produce 400,000 tpa of 100 percent recycled containerboard each year.

PM11 is the final part of SAICA's plan to become an integrated player in the UK,providing a closed-loop solution for the manufacture of environmentally friendly performance papers and corrugated packaging.
